Authenticom Group won a Bronze Stevie Award for Great Employers (Computer Software, up to 250 employees), its second consecutive year, highlighting an employee-first strategy including a quarterly revenue-incentive program and an eNPS score of 52. The company also cited recent business milestones such as the iSKY asset acquisition, the launch of AuthenticomCX, and creation of Data Experience Management (DXM) to unify automotive connectivity, governance, and predictive intelligence. The announcement is positive for company culture branding but is unlikely to materially move markets given its awards-driven nature.
This is more of a verification signal than a fundamental catalyst. In dealership-data plumbing, the binding constraint is not top-line demand but execution quality: retaining engineers, support staff, and implementation talent reduces churn friction and shortens onboarding, which can protect renewal rates and cross-sell attach over the next 1-3 quarters. If management can keep delivery teams intact while integrating acquired assets, the economic benefit shows up first in lower customer defection and then in margin leverage, not in immediate headline revenue.
The second-order competitive effect is where this matters: smaller integration vendors and point solutions with weaker culture tend to leak talent during periods of consolidation, which raises their effective cost of service and slows feature velocity. That can widen the moat for ARBU if DXM becomes the system-of-record layer in automotive retail data workflows; if not, the signal fades quickly. Over 6-18 months, the real check is whether higher employee engagement translates into lower implementation cycle times, better gross retention, and measurable expansion in connected locations, not awards.
Contrarian view: the market often overprices "culture" as a moat in B2B software. Buyers pay for uptime, API reliability, and procurement simplicity; a workplace award does not change those variables. If the next print does not show improved retention, margin, or integration throughput, this news becomes noise and any initial pop should be faded rather than chased.
